Time Warner OT Case May Cause Classification Headaches

By Erin Coe (October 19, 2012, 8:07 PM EDT) -- In taking up a proposed overtime class action against Time Warner Cable Inc., the California Supreme Court will consider whether employers can allocate commission payments over the period of time they were earned, and attorneys say a ruling against the practice could burden companies with new monitoring rules and a fresh wave of misclassification class actions....
